GameCamp! 2008 is a summer program for high school and middle school students interested in careers in the video game industry. It is headquartered in Austin, Texas and is taught by REAL game developers, students will learn the world of video game creation from start to finish. iD TEch Camps offers weeklong day and overnight summer technology programs for ages 7-17 at 50 prestigious universities in 23 states. This includes the University of Houston, UT Austin, and Southern Methodist University. Create 2D and 3D video games, build robots, design websites, film and edit digital movies, create your own comic book, learn programming and more. With one computer per student and an average of five students per staff, campers are given the attention they need to excel and take home a project at the end of the weeklong course.
